Default Re: RX-8?

1. Do not crank it up and shut it off with out letting it run for atleast 10-15 minutes.
2. Gas mileage sucks donkey dick.
3. Best practice is to add 6-8 oz of 2 stroke motor oil, helps with oil consumption/improve gas mileage a little.
4. Keep a spare quart of oil, you will burn about a 1/2 quart of oil every 400 miles or so.
